Craig’s Legacy in Sports Communication

Jermaine Craig had a significant impact on South Africa’s sporting landscape. As the chief orchestrator of communications for the 2010 FIFA World Cup bid, Craig’s larger-than-life persona was an amalgamation of unity, strong advocacy for the African narrative on the global stage, and unyielding support for South African sports. His efforts were instrumental in the seamless execution of the World Cup, leaving an indelible mark on Africa and beyond.

Breaking Stereotypes with Football

The World Cup was not just a grand spectacle of football, but it also broke preconceived notions about Africa. The vuvuzela became symbolic of Africa’s invincible spirit, and Craig was at the forefront of this transformative journey. Through captivating storytelling and meaningful engagement, he curated the country’s image, showcasing its best to the world.
